区块链技术作为一项颠覆性的新兴技术,近年来取得了飞速发展。这一技术不仅在金融领域引起了广泛的关注,同时也在各个行业掀起了创新的浪潮。随着数字货币的兴起,区块链钱包APP的开发需求逐渐增加。对于想要进入这一领域的开发者和企业来说,区块链钱包APP开发的合法性便成了一个重要关注点。本文将围绕这一话题进行深入分析,探讨区块链钱包APP开发是否合法,并分析与其相关的法律问题、市场现状、风险以及未来发展趋势。

一、区块链钱包APP的基本概念

区块链钱包是指通过区块链技术实现的存储和管理数字资产的一种软件。用户可以通过区块链钱包进行数字货币的存储、转账和交易等操作。通常,区块链钱包分为热钱包和冷钱包两种类型:热钱包是始终连接互联网的,便于用户进行日常交易;冷钱包则是离线存储,安全性较高,适合长期持有数字资产。

二、法律环境对区块链钱包APP开发的影响

各国对区块链技术和数字货币的法律监管差别很大。有些国家对区块链钱包的开发持支持态度,而另一些国家则采取禁止或严格监管的措施。以中国为例,虽然区块链技术被广泛认可,但数字货币的交易和ICO(首次代币发行)被禁止,这使得区块链钱包的开发和使用受到了一定限制。

三、区块链钱包APP开发的法律风险

区块链钱包的开发面临多方面的法律风险,包括但不限于以下几个方面:

1. 合规性风险:开发者必须确保钱包应用符合当地的法律法规,这包括金融犯罪预防、反洗钱(Anti-Money Laundering, AML)和客户身份验证(Know Your Customer, KYC)等法律要求。若不符合相关法律,可能会面临罚款或刑事责任。

2. 用户隐私保护:由于钱包应用涉及大量个人信息和交易数据,开发者需要遵循数据保护法规,如GDPR等,确保用户信息不被滥用。

3. 诈骗和欺诈行为:区块链行业的快速发展也带来了大量的欺诈行为,开发者需要采取相应措施避免钱包应用被用于诈骗活动,保护用户的资产安全。

四、市场现状与趋势

随着数字资产市场的发展,区块链钱包APP需求不断增加。目前市场上已经有许多知名的区块链钱包应用,如MetaMask、Trust Wallet、Exodus等。未来,随着技术的不断进步和用户需求的提升,区块链钱包应用将更加智能化、人性化,同时也会面临更多的监管挑战。

五、开发区块链钱包APP需考虑的因素

开发者在进行区块链钱包APP开发时,需要考虑以下几个因素:

1. 技术栈选择:选择适合的开发语言和技术框架,以确保应用的性能和安全性。

2. 用户体验:结合用户需求,设计友好和易用的界面,提高用户黏性。

3. 安全性设计:在数据传输和存储过程中,采用加密技术和防护措施,确保用户资产安全。

六、可能相关问题

1. 区块链钱包的法律地位是怎样的?

区块链钱包的法律地位因国家和地区而异。在一些国家,区块链钱包被视为合法的数字资产存储工具,可用于个人或企业的数字资产管理;而在另一些国家,由于对数字货币的监管不明确,区块链钱包的合法性却存在争议。这要求开发者和用户在创建和使用区块链钱包时,充分了解其所在地区的法律法规,以避免潜在的法律风险。

2. 制作区块链钱包APP需要具备哪些技术?

开发区块链钱包APP需要掌握多种技术,主要包括:

- 区块链基础知识:了解基本的区块链概念,包括共识机制、智能合约等。

- 编程语言:掌握至少一种编程语言(如JavaScript, Python等),以进行后端和前端的开发。

- 加密技术:掌握密码学原理,确保数字资产的安全。

- 数据库管理:在区块链钱包中,需要进行用户数据和交易记录的管理,了解相关数据库技术。

综上所述,开发区块链钱包APP是一个复杂的工程,开发者需具备多方面的知识和技能。

3. 开发区块链钱包APP需遵循哪些合规规定?

为了确保合法合规,开发区块链钱包APP时,开发者需要关注以下合规规定:

- 反洗钱法(AML):确保钱包应用配合政府机构打击洗钱和金融诈骗。

- 客户身份验证(KYC):在注册用户时,要求他们提供身份验证信息,以验证其身份。

- 数据保护法:遵循当地数据保护法规,确保用户数据的安全和隐私。

随着各国对区块链技术监管的不断变化,开发者需保持对相关法律法规的持续关注,以规避潜在风险。

4. 如何保障区块链钱包APP的安全性?

保障区块链钱包APP的安全性是开发过程中至关重要的一环,开发者需采取以下措施:

- 数据加密:在数据传输和存储过程中,使用先进的加密算法,防止数据被黑客截获或篡改。

- 代码审计:定期进行代码审计和漏洞扫描,及时发现和修复安全漏洞。

- 双重身份验证:引入双重身份验证机制,提高用户账户的安全性。

通过以上安全措施,可以有效降低区块链钱包被攻击的风险,保护用户的数字资产。

5. 区块链钱包APP的未来发展趋势是什么?

未来,区块链钱包APP的发展趋势将体现在以下几个方面:

- 智能合约集成:随着智能合约技术的成熟,区块链钱包将可能与智能合约平台实现更深层次的结合,提升用户体验。

- 更高的安全性:随着网络安全技术的发展,区块链钱包将采用更加先进的安全措施,确保用户资产的安全性。

- 用户体验提升:开发者将更加关注用户界面的设计与,使用户在使用区块链钱包时更加便捷、舒适。

整体而言,区块链钱包APP将迎来更广阔的发展前景,但在此过程中也面临着更大的挑战和机遇。

综上所述,区块链钱包APP的开发是否合法,不仅与法律法规的变化密切相关,同时也需要开发者考虑各城市的市场需求和技术趋势。在合法合规、保障用户安全的基础上,开发出更具创新性和使用价值的钱包产品,将是未来的关键所在。